Role Summary/Purpose: The Lead Engineer for Electrical Engineering will develop the design of electrical components for thermal power plants. The equipment will be designed with a focus on systems integration providing a safe and reliable connection between the customer's grid and the generator.
Essential Responsibilities: The team will be responsible for the entire electrical system from the generator terminals to the customer's point of connection. The equipment includes; the generator protection system, grid interface, medium and low voltage distribution and generator controls. The main focus of the team will be centered on the fulfillment of customer orders globally where there is a strong collaboration between the engineers on the team and the customers to develop the electrical system for the project.

In addition, you will:

  • Attend Order Release Meetings to ensure the scope definition is accurate for the electrical equipment
  • Review contracts during the proposal phase for technical content and scope (mainly looking for items outside of standard design or cost models)
  • Complete Field Modification Instructions to modify Existing Electrical Systems
  • Work with Master Schedulers to ensure project schedules reflect the electrical systems scope
  • Be the focal point for the preliminary engineering of the Electrical System related to the creation of project specific drawings for use by the customer and in manufacturing of the equipment
  • Produce interconnect lists for wiring within and between Electrical Panels
  • Generate and validate project Bill of Materials
  • Develop and provide quality checks for the one line diagram
  • Improve quality assurance and drive consistency and adherence to quality procedures and requirements consistent with Engineering quality processes and procedures
  • Drive continuous improvement of design and drawing quality performance through Six Sigma and Lean Six Sigma principles and methodology
  • Monitor and drive for Cost of Failure / Quality (COF / COQ) reduction in the Electrical System
  • Establish programs to monitor and improve design and drawing process capabilities for CTQs
  • Providing technical guidance to suppliers toward assuring product / process compliance with engineering drawings and specifications
  • Work closely with Sourcing COEs, Business teams, and Engineering to eliminate roadblocks and communication barriers that may affect quality requirements
